Guaranteeing Instant Payment App Safeguards: Shielding Your Payments
Keeping your digital transactions via Instant Payment apps is critical in today's online landscape. Many protection protocols are built-in to avoid fraudulent activity, but user awareness is just as necessary. Regularly upgrade your app to the newest version, as these updates often include essential protection fixes. Be cautious of fake emails or messages requesting personal or financial information. Consistently confirm the recipient's details before initiating a payment and turn on dual confirmation whenever available for an extra layer of protection.
Understanding Unified Payments Interface vs. Mobile Banking
When it comes to handling your money, both UPI and cellular banking offer convenient options. However, they function quite differently. Smartphone banking is essentially an app associated to your current bank account, allowing you to execute transactions like invoice payments and move cash directly from your account. In comparison, UPI isn’t tied to a one financial institution; it's a payment gateway that allows you to transmit funds to others using just their UPI ID, regardless of their bank. Think of it like this: smartphone financial services uses your credit union's infrastructure, while UPI delivers a system for various credit unions to connect.
